ABSTRACT
The preparation and evaluation of a novel class of CB2 agonists based on a benzimidazole moiety are reported. They showed binding affinities up to 1nM towards the CB2 receptor with partial to full agonist potencies. They also demonstrated good to excellent selectivity (>1000-fold) over the CB1 receptor.

ABSTRACT
The first Directed ortho Metalation (DoM) reaction of aryl O-carbamates on polystyrene-divinylbenzene (PS-DVB) resin using a trityl linker is described. Using low temperatures and short metalation times, a range of electrophiles have been introduced to give, after cleavage from support, substituted benzyl alcohols in high purity. [reaction: see text]
